目录
什么是Shadowsocks
Shadowsocks是一种基于SOCKS5代理的加密传输协议,可以有效地突破网络审查和封锁,实现科学上网。它是一个开源项目,由一位中国程序员开发并维护。相比于传统的VPN技术,Shadowsocks具有更好的性能和更低的成本。
为什么需要使用Shadowsocks
在当前的网络环境下,许多网站和服务都会受到各种形式的封锁和限制。使用Shadowsocks可以有效地突破这些限制,访问被屏蔽的内容,获取更广阔的信息资源。同时,Shadowsocks还具有较高的隐私性和安全性,能够保护用户的上网行为和隐私信息。
在Android 4.4上安装Shadowsocks
下载Shadowsocks客户端
在Android 4.4系统上使用Shadowsocks,需要先下载安装相应的客户端软件。目前市面上有多种Shadowsocks客户端可供选择,例如:
- Shadowsocks-Android:这是由Shadowsocks官方团队开发维护的Android客户端,功能全面,稳定性好。
- ShadowsocksR-Android:在原版Shadowsocks的基础上增加了更多功能和优化,是另一个广受欢迎的Android客户端选择。
- Kitsunebi:这是一款功能强大的Shadowsocks客户端,界面简洁美观,支持多种代理模式。
你可以根据自己的需求和偏好选择合适的客户端进行下载安装。
配置Shadowsocks服务器信息
安装好Shadowsocks客户端后,需要对其进行相应的配置,才能正常使用代理服务。主要包括以下步骤:
- 获取Shadowsocks服务器的连接信息,包括服务器地址、端口号、加密方式和密码等。这些信息通常可以从Shadowsocks服务提供商那里获得。
- 在Shadowsocks客户端的设置界面中,输入获取的服务器连接信息。
- 选择合适的代理模式,例如绕过局域网、全局代理等,并进行相应的调整。
- 启动Shadowsocks客户端,检查连接状态是否正常。
配置完成后,你就可以开始使用Shadowsocks代理进行科学上网了。
Shadowsocks使用技巧
选择合适的服务器
Shadowsocks的服务器位置和网络状况会直接影响到代理的性能和稳定性。通常情况下,选择离自己地理位置较近的服务器会获得更好的连接体验。同时,也要关注服务器的带宽、延迟和负载情况,选择最佳的服务器进行连接。
优化Shadowsocks连接
为了进一步提高Shadowsocks的使用体验,可以尝试以下优化方法:
- 调整Shadowsocks客户端的网络参数,如TCP连接超时时间、缓存大小等,以适应不同的网络环境。
- 启用UDP转发功能,可以提高Shadowsocks在某些网络环境下的性能。
- 定期清理Shadowsocks客户端的缓存和日志,避免占用过多设备资源。
- 使用分流模式,只对需要代理的应用程序启用Shadowsocks,可以节省系统资源。
常见问题排查
在使用Shadowsocks过程中,可能会遇到一些常见的问题,比如连接失败、网速变慢等。可以从以下几个方面进行排查和解决:
- 检查Shadowsocks服务器信息是否输入正确,端口号、加密方式等是否与服务提供商提供的一致。
- 尝试切换Shadowsocks服务器或更换加密方式,排查是否为特定服务器或加密方式的问题。
- 检查设备网络连接是否正常,可以尝试重启设备或切换网络环境。
- 清理Shadowsocks客户端缓存和日志,优化客户端配置参数。
- 如果问题仍无法解决,可以联系Shadowsocks服务提供商寻求技术支持。
Shadowsocks使用常见问题解答
Q1: 为什么有时候Shadowsocks会突然断开连接?
A: Shadowsocks断连可能有多种原因,比如服务器故障、网络抖动、客户端配置问题等。建议检查服务器状态,调整客户端参数,并尝试切换其他服务器。如果问题持续存在,可以联系服务提供商寻求帮助。
Q2: Shadowsocks的网速为什么会变慢?
A: Shadowsocks网速变慢可能是由于以下原因导致的:
- 服务器负载过高或带宽不足
- 客户端配置不当,如加密方式、缓存大小等设置不合理
- 设备网络环境不佳,如网络拥塞、信号弱等 可以尝试切换服务器、优化客户端配置或检查网络环境等方式来解决。
Q3: 如何选择Shadowsocks服务器?
A: 选择Shadowsocks服务器时,需要综合考虑以下因素:
- 地理位置:离自己较近的服务器可以获得更低的网络延迟
- 带宽和负载:选择带宽充足、负载较低的服务器
- 稳定性:选择有良好口碑和运营记录的服务提供商
- 加密方式:根据自身需求选择合适的加密算法
- 价格和付费方式:结合自身预算进行选择
Q4: Shadowsocks可以同时用于多个设备吗?
A: 可以的,Shadowsocks支持多设备同时使用。只需要在各个设备上安装Shadowsocks客户端,并配置相同的服务器信息即可。不过需要注意服务商是否限制了同时在线设备数量,超出限制可能会导致连接失败。
Q5: Shadowsocks是否安全可靠?
A: Shadowsocks相比于传统VPN技术而言,具有更好的安全性和隐私保护。它采用加密传输协议,可以有效防止网络监听和流量劫持。同时,Shadowsocks是开源项目,代码透明,也可以提高用户的安全信任度。不过,用户仍需谨慎选择服务提供商,确保服务商本身的安全性。